Transaction 3d07a8a9c1cc916e35f49cb751016e7770ef241c765eec9b39877fa7a56a0802
1 Input
2 Outputs
- 3d07a8a9c1cc916e35f49cb751016e7770ef241c765eec9b39877fa7a56a0802:0
- 3d07a8a9c1cc916e35f49cb751016e7770ef241c765eec9b39877fa7a56a0802:1
value 54847800
address 3LsjbfJqChruExuPtcazbBDmwwTDz4wSBe
value 140000000
address 1F6m5dr4pQg1ovyekSA9nVDYNKhhaMokvK